The GBIC specification calls for a range of 4.75V to 5.25 volts as described in Table 2.
The maximum voltage of 6V is not to be applied continuously.

RX_LOS, TX_DISABLE, and TX_FAULT are TTL signals as described in Table 3.
MOD_DEF(1) (SCL) and MOD_DEF(2) (SDA) are open drain CMOS signals (see
section XI, “Serial Communication Protocol”). Both MOD_DEF(1) and MOD_DEF(2)
must be pulled up to host_Vcc. For more detailed information, see sections 5.3.1 – 5.3.8
in the GBIC Specification Revision 5.5
